CSS3的核心功能

CSS3带来了许多令人兴奋的新特性,这些特性极大地扩展了CSS的功能范围。CSS3支持圆角和阴影,这使得设计师可以轻松地创建出更加柔和和立体的界面元素。CSS3引入了渐变背景,允许设计师在不使用图像的情况下创建复杂的背景效果。CSS3还支持动画和过渡效果,这使得网页元素可以在用户交互时产生动态变化,从而增强用户的参与感。
CSS3的应用场景
响应式设计
响应式设计是现代网页设计的一个重要趋势,它要求网页能够根据不同的设备和屏幕尺寸自动调整布局和样式。CSS3的媒体查询功能是实现响应式设计的关键工具。通过媒体查询,设计师可以为不同的设备定义不同的样式规则,从而确保网页在各种设备上都能提供良好的用户体验。
动画和交互效果
CSS3的动画和过渡效果为网页设计师提供了强大的工具,可以用来创建各种动态效果。,设计师可以使用CSS3动画来实现按钮的悬停效果、页面的加载动画等。这些动态效果不仅能够吸引用户的注意力,还能够提高网页的互动性和趣味性。
如何有效利用CSS3
要有效地利用CSS3,设计师需要掌握其核心特性,并了解如何将这些特性应用到实际项目中。设计师应该熟悉CSS3的各种新特性,如圆角、阴影、渐变、动画等。设计师需要学会使用媒体查询来实现响应式设计。设计师还应该了解如何优化CSS代码,以提高网页的加载速度和性能。
CSS3是现代网页设计中不可或缺的一部分。通过掌握其核心功能和应用场景,设计师可以创造出更加丰富和吸引人的网页界面。同时,有效地利用CSS3还能够提高网页的用户体验和性能。希望本文能够帮助读者更好地理解和应用CSS3,从而提升自己的网页设计技能。
常见问题解答
1. CSS3和CSS2有什么区别?
CSS3引入了许多新特性,如圆角、阴影、渐变、动画等,这些特性在CSS2中是不支持的。CSS3还增强了选择器的功能,并引入了媒体查询等新功能。
2. 如何使用CSS3实现响应式设计?
使用CSS3的媒体查询功能,可以为不同的设备和屏幕尺寸定义不同的样式规则,从而实现响应式设计。
3. CSS3动画有哪些应用场景?
CSS3动画可以应用于各种动态效果,如按钮的悬停效果、页面的加载动画等,这些动态效果能够增强网页的互动性和趣味性。